TPE Sex Doll: What Sets Them Apart and How to Choose

What makes TPE different from silicone

TPE (thermoplastic elastomer) feels softer and more skin-like than most silicone alternatives. The material compresses naturally under pressure, which creates a more realistic tactile experience during physical contact. And that texture comes at a lower price point—usually 30% to 50% less than equivalent silicone models.

But TPE isn't just cheaper silicone. It's a completely different polymer blend with its own trade-offs.

The material is porous, which means it absorbs moisture, oils, and bacteria more easily than medical-grade silicone. So cleaning becomes more involved, and long-term durability depends heavily on how carefully you maintain the doll. TPE also stains more readily when exposed to dark fabrics, ink, or certain lubricants.

If you prioritize lifelike softness and want to stay within a tighter budget, TPE makes sense. If you'd rather minimize upkeep and prefer a material that holds up better over years of use, silicone may be worth the extra cost.

The softness-durability balance

TPE sex dolls compress under touch in a way that mimics real skin texture. Press into the material, and it rebounds slowly—closer to how human tissue behaves than firmer silicone formulations.

That softness comes with limits. The material tears more easily than silicone, especially around joints, insertion points, and areas under repeated stress. Small rips can usually be repaired with TPE glue, but they happen more often than with higher-durometer silicone bodies.

Most TPE dolls also become slightly tacky after washing, which is why manufacturers recommend applying renewal powder (usually cornstarch or specialized talc) after each cleaning session. Without it, the surface can feel sticky or attract dust.

Because TPE is thermoplastic, it softens slightly when warm and firms up in cold environments. Some users actually prefer this—it makes the doll feel warmer to the touch after a hot bath. Others find the temperature sensitivity inconvenient, especially if storage conditions fluctuate.

How maintenance works in practice

TPE requires more attention than silicone, but it's manageable if you follow a routine.

After each use, wash the relevant areas with warm water and antibacterial soap. Pat dry thoroughly—moisture trapped inside can lead to mold growth. Once dry, dust the surface with renewal powder to restore the skin-like texture and prevent tackiness.

For full-body cleaning, some owners use a removable vaginal insert system (if the model supports it), which simplifies internal cleaning. Others prefer built-in anatomy and use a vaginal irrigator or handheld shower attachment to flush and dry the cavity.

Staining is the bigger issue. Dark clothing, denim, leather, and newsprint can transfer color to TPE within hours. If you dress your doll, stick to light-colored fabrics or use a protective underlayer. If staining occurs, acne cream with benzoyl peroxide can sometimes lift the color over several days, though results vary.

Store the doll in a cool, dry space away from direct sunlight. UV exposure degrades TPE faster than silicone, causing discoloration and surface cracking over time. A hanging storage solution or a padded case works best to avoid pressure marks from prolonged contact with hard surfaces.

Mini dolls vs full-size TPE models

A 100cm mini sex doll weighs significantly less than a full-size model—usually between 15 and 25 pounds instead of 60 to 90 pounds. That makes handling, positioning, and storage far easier, especially if you live in a smaller space or plan to move the doll frequently.

Mini TPE dolls also cost less, typically ranging from $400 to $1,200 depending on brand and customization options. Full-size models start around $1,000 and can exceed $3,000 for premium builds with upgraded skeleton systems, custom faces, or AI-responsive heads.

The trade-off is proportion. A 60cm mini sex doll or 100cm version won't have the same anatomical realism or joint articulation as a 158cm or 170cm doll. Smaller models often lack full finger articulation, detailed facial sculpting, or standing capability. Some buyers prefer the compact size for practical reasons; others find the proportions less immersive.

If you're trying TPE for the first time and want to test the material without committing to a full-size purchase, a mini doll can be a reasonable entry point. Just know that upgrading later means buying a completely different product, not just adding features to your existing one.

TPE vs silicone: the decision most people face

TPE feels softer. Silicone lasts longer.

That's the short version. Here's what it actually means for day-to-day use.

TPE compresses more naturally under touch, so if realism in texture is your priority, TPE delivers. Silicone tends to feel firmer unless you invest in dual-layer or gel-injected silicone, which narrows the texture gap but increases cost significantly.

Silicone is non-porous, so it resists staining, absorbs less moisture, and cleans more easily. You can use silicone-safe lubricants without worrying about material degradation. And because silicone holds its shape better over time, high-end models maintain appearance and structural integrity longer than TPE dolls under the same usage conditions.

But silicone costs more—often double the price of a comparable TPE model. A basic TPE doll from a reputable manufacturer might run $1,200 to $1,800, while a similar silicone version could hit $2,500 to $4,000. Premium silicone dolls with custom sculpting, platinum-grade material, and advanced skeletons can exceed $6,000.

If your budget is under $2,000 and you're comfortable with regular maintenance, TPE makes sense. If you'd rather minimize upkeep and can afford the higher upfront cost, silicone reduces long-term hassle.

Some brands now offer hybrid models with a silicone head and TPE body, which balances facial detail with overall affordability. Worth checking if you want better durability where it shows most.

What to check before buying

Not all TPE is the same. Cheaper dolls often use lower-grade polymer blends that tear easily, smell strongly out of the box, or degrade within months. Better manufacturers use medical-grade or platinum-cured TPE, which costs more but lasts significantly longer.

Look for dolls with an articulated metal skeleton. Cheaper models use basic wire frames that bend out of shape quickly. Higher-quality skeletons support shrugging shoulders, finger articulation, and standing capability (if the feet include bolt holes for stability).

Check whether the doll has a removable vaginal insert. This feature simplifies cleaning but may reduce realism slightly. Built-in anatomy feels more natural but requires more effort to dry thoroughly after washing.

Customization options vary widely. Most brands let you choose skin tone, eye color, hair style, and breast size. Some offer custom face sculpting, pubic hair styles, or upgraded skeletons with double-jointed elbows and knees. Decide what matters before adding features that inflate the price.

Shipping is another factor. Full-size dolls ship in large, heavy boxes—usually with discreet exterior labeling, but not always. Confirm shipping discretion with the seller if privacy matters. Some companies also charge extra for remote delivery or require signature confirmation.

And check the warranty. Reputable sellers cover manufacturing defects for at least 3 to 6 months. Avoid sellers that refuse returns or warranties entirely.

Popular TPE doll sizes and body types

Most TPE sex dolls fall between 140cm and 170cm in height, which roughly translates to 4'7" to 5'7". Taller models (175cm and up) exist but weigh more and cost more due to the additional material and structural support required.

Body types range from skinny sex doll builds under 50 pounds to curvier models with L-cup or M-cup proportions that can exceed 90 pounds. Heavier dolls feel more realistic in terms of weight distribution but become harder to move and position.

If you're looking for specific aesthetics, some brands focus on niche styles. Japanese sex doll models typically feature smaller frames, softer facial features, and lighter skin tones. Black sex doll options are increasingly available with realistic skin tones, facial diversity, and hair textures that match a broader range of preferences.

Male TPE dolls exist but represent a smaller segment of the market. Most adult male sex doll options are silicone due to durability concerns around heavier builds and more rigid skeletal requirements.

AI features and upgrades

Some TPE dolls now support AI-responsive heads that simulate conversation, facial expressions, and limited head movement. The technology varies—some systems use pre-programmed responses, while others integrate voice recognition and learning algorithms that adapt over time.

An AI sex doll head typically adds $500 to $1,500 to the base price, depending on the complexity of the system. Most AI heads require charging, and some need periodic software updates via app or USB connection.

Does it improve the experience? That depends on what you're looking for. If companionship and interaction matter as much as physical realism, AI can add a layer of engagement. If you're focused purely on tactile experience, the added cost may not be worth it.

Keep in mind that AI features are still evolving. Early versions had limited vocabulary, robotic speech patterns, and frequent glitches. Newer models have improved significantly, but they're not yet close to human-level conversation. Basically, they work best as supplemental features, not primary selling points.

What can go wrong

The most common issue is tearing, especially around joints and insertion points. TPE stretches, but it doesn't always return to its original shape if pulled too far. Small tears can be patched with TPE adhesive, but larger rips may require professional repair or replacement parts.

Staining is another frequent complaint. Dark fabrics, dyes, and certain lubricants transfer color to TPE within hours. Once stained, the material is difficult to restore fully. Prevention is easier than correction.

Odor can be a problem with lower-grade TPE. New dolls sometimes smell strongly of plastic or chemicals, which fades over time but can take weeks to dissipate. Higher-quality TPE has less initial odor and airs out faster.

Mold growth happens if moisture gets trapped inside the doll and isn't dried properly. Internal cavities are especially prone to this. If you notice a musty smell or visible discoloration inside the doll, stop use immediately and clean thoroughly with antibacterial solution.

Skeletal damage is less common but harder to fix. If a joint bends beyond its limit, the internal metal frame can snap or deform. Most skeletons are not user-repairable, so rough handling can lead to permanent posing limitations.

Who TPE works best for

If you want a lifelike feel without spending $3,000 or more, TPE delivers. The material compresses naturally, feels warm to the touch, and costs significantly less than premium silicone.

TPE also makes sense if you're buying your first doll and want to test the experience before committing to a higher-end model. A mid-range TPE doll lets you explore customization, maintenance, and storage requirements without the financial risk of a top-tier purchase.

Where TPE doesn't fit: if you hate routine maintenance, if you need maximum durability, or if you want the lowest possible upkeep over years of use. In those cases, silicone is the better long-term investment despite the higher upfront cost.

And if you're considering a life-size sex doll for the first time, think about weight and storage before choosing size. A 170cm TPE doll might look more realistic, but a 140cm version is easier to handle, clean, and store—especially if you're new to the category.
